Saudi Arabia will continue evacuation of people stranded in Sudan, Prince Faisal tells UN chief

RIYADH —
Foreign Minister Prince Faisal bin Farhan has confirmed to the United Nations Secretary-General António Guterres Saudi Arabia's determination to continue evacuating people from other countries that sought the Kingdom's assistance to bring home their citizens from war-torn Sudan.

Prince Faisal gave the assurances to the UN chief in a phone call he made on Thursday. During the phone conversation, they discussed the efforts made to stop the military escalation between the warring parties in Sudan,

The two sides also discussed efforts made in providing the necessary protection for the Sudanese civilians and foreigners living in Sudan.

Prince Faisal reviewed with the UN chief the aspects of cooperation between Saudi Arabia and the UN, in addition to discussing the latest international developments and efforts to enhance global peace and security.
